Herein, how does a pinhole camera works?

A pinhole camera is a simple camera without a lens but with a tiny aperture, a pinhole camera – effectively a light-proof box with a small hole in one side. Light from a scene passes through the aperture and projects an inverted image on the opposite side of the box, which is known as the camera obscura effect.

Thereof, how long do you expose a pinhole camera?

For example, if the measured exposure time for f 22 is 1/60 second, the calculation for our pinhole camera with an f number of 250 is: (250/22)2 = 129. The measured time is increased 129 times, therefore the exposure time for the pinhole camera will be 2 seconds (rounded).

What is the principle of a pinhole camera?

When the shutter is opened, light shines through to imprint an image on photographic paper or film placed at the back of the camera. Pinhole cameras rely on the fact that light travels in straight lines – a principle called the rectilinear theory of light. This makes the image appear upside down in the camera.

Do pinhole glasses improve vision?

Pinhole glasses could improve your vision, but only temporarily. Putting on pinhole glasses can restrict the amount of light that enters your pupils. This reduces the field of what doctors call the “blur circle” on the back of your retina. This gives your vision extra clarity when you have the glasses on.

Why is an image upside down in a pinhole camera?

Answer: In the pinhole camera, the light enters through a very fine hole and is propagated in a straight line. An inverted image is formed in a pinhole camera because the light rays coming from the top and bottom of the object intersect at the pinhole.

What happens if the size of a pinhole camera is increased?

Answer: If the size of the hole in a pinhole camera is as big as the size of a green gram then the sharpness in the image decreases. The image becomes thick and the image is blur. If the size of the hole of a pinhole camera increases then more light enters and disturbs the formation of the image.

How do you find the focal length of a pinhole camera?

Once the pinhole diameter is determined (or already known) then the focal length of the camera can be calculated. The formula is; focal length = (pinhole diameter / 0.03679)2. The focal length is the distance that the pinhole should be from the film.

How does the pinhole camera relate to modern photography?

The pinhole forces every point emitting light in the scene to form a small point on the film, so the image is crisp. The reason a normal camera uses a lens rather than a pinhole is because the lens creates a much larger hole through which light can make it onto the film, meaning the film can be exposed faster.

What is Camera Obscura in photography?

Camera obscura, ancestor of the photographic camera. The Latin name means “dark chamber,” and the earliest versions, dating to antiquity, consisted of small darkened rooms with light admitted through a single tiny hole. The introduction of a light-sensitive plate by J. -N. Niepce created photography.

How was the pinhole camera invented?

The Arab scholar Ibn Al-Haytham (945–1040), also known as Alhazen, is generally credited as being the first person to study how we see. He invented the camera obscura, the precursor to the pinhole camera, to demonstrate how light can be used to project an image onto a flat surface.
